The juvenile stage of an Indian Ringneck Parakeet begins around six to eight weeks of age when the bird is substantially feathered and continues through roughly one year of age, though full physical maturity — including the development of the iconic neck ring in males — may not be complete until two to three years of age. During this period, the bird undergoes dramatic physical transformation, transitioning from a clumsy, downy fledgling into a sleek, agile flyer with the distinctive long tail and elegant proportions the species is known for.
Feather development is one of the most visible markers of juvenile growth. By the time the bird fledges, its body is largely covered in contour feathers, though these juvenile feathers are typically duller and less vibrant than the plumage it will eventually develop after its first full molt. The long central tail feathers, a hallmark of the species, grow in gradually and may not reach their full length until the bird is well past six months of age. During this growth period, the tail feathers are fragile and can be damaged easily by cages that are too small or by rough handling.
Weight should be monitored regularly throughout the juvenile period, though the intense daily weighing of the neonatal stage can be relaxed to weekly checks once the bird is fully weaned and eating independently. A healthy juvenile Indian Ringneck will typically weigh between 115 and 140 grams, depending on the individual and its subspecies. Significant weight fluctuations — either sudden drops or unexplained gains — should be investigated, as they can indicate illness, dietary problems, or stress.
The bird's beak and feet continue to develop and harden during this stage. The beak, which appears oversized relative to the head in very young birds, gradually becomes more proportional. Providing appropriate chewing materials such as untreated wood perches, mineral blocks, and safe foraging toys is important for beak health and development. Perches of varying diameters help the feet develop strength and dexterity, which are essential for a species that uses its feet extensively for climbing and manipulating food.
